What is the difference between Graduate Product Design vs Junior Product Designer?

AspectGraduate Product DesignJunior Product Designer
QualificationsTypically recent graduates with a degree in design or related fieldUsually 1-2 years of experience in product design
Work EnvironmentEntry-level, learning-focused, often in internship or trainee rolesFull-time, collaborative teams working on real projects
ResponsibilitiesAssisting in design tasks, learning tools and processesContributing to design development, executing tasks under supervision

In summary, Graduate Product Design roles are aimed at individuals starting their careers, focusing on learning and skill development. Junior Product Designers have some experience and take on more responsibility in real project work, often transitioning from graduate roles.

What kinds of projects can a Graduate Product Designer expect to work on, and how does collaboration typically occur within the team?

As a Graduate Product Designer, you can expect to contribute to a variety of projects, ranging from user research and wireframing to prototyping and final UI design. You'll often collaborate closely with cross-functional teams, including engineers, product managers, and senior designers, through regular stand-ups, design critiques, and brainstorming sessions. This collaborative environment not only helps develop your technical and soft skills but also exposes you to the end-to-end product development process. It's common to receive mentorship and feedback, which supports rapid learning and professional growth during the early stages of your career.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Graduate Product Designer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Graduate Product Designer, you need a solid understanding of design principles, user experience (UX), and a relevant degree such as industrial, product, or interaction design. Familiarity with industry-standard tools like Adobe Creative Suite, Figma, SolidWorks, or CAD software is typically required. Creativity, adaptability, and strong communication skills help you collaborate effectively and translate user needs into innovative solutions. These skills are essential for producing functional, user-centered products that meet both business goals and customer expectations.

What are Graduate Product Designers?

Graduate Product Designers are entry-level professionals who have recently completed a degree in product design or a related field and are starting their careers in designing and developing new products. They work under the guidance of senior designers and collaborate with engineers, marketers, and manufacturers to create functional and visually appealing products. Their responsibilities often include creating sketches, prototypes, and technical drawings, as well as conducting user research and testing. This role is ideal for those looking to gain hands-on experience in the design industry and develop their creative and technical skills.
